http://dev.timmermanreport.com/2024/04/not-they-can-not-lawfully-request-you-to-spend/ WebJun 15, 2024 · Steps to Take to Report Your Loved One’s Passing. 1.Get multiple copies of the certified death certificate. 2.Report the death to all three credit bureaus. Send a certified letter to the three credit bureaus. You will want to include the Name, Social Security Number, date of birth, date of date, and the last address. Or even … WebNotifying the credit bureaus. To flag the credit files of a person who is deceased, the surviving spouse or executor needs to notify the three national credit bureaus in writing. The surviving spouse or executor must include the following specific information along with the alert request: 1) a copy of death certificate, and 2) proof of ...

WebAug 23, 2024 · Contact a credit bureau by phone: Experian - 888-397-3742 Equifax - 800-685-111 TransUnion - 800-888-4213 Here's what you'll need before you send a letter to one of the three bureaus: A copy of the de death certificate The full, legal name of the decedent Their social security number Their date of birth Their date of death
